Crunchy Pea Salad
photo by lazyme
- Ready In:
- 20mins
- Ingredients:
- 8
- Serves:
-
6
ingredients
- 1 (20 ounce) package frozen baby peas
- 1 cup diced celery
- 1 cup chopped cauliflower
- 1⁄4 cup diced green onion
- 1 cup chopped cashews
- 1⁄2 cup sour cream
- 1 cup ranch salad dressing
- crisply cooked & crumbled bacon, for garnish (Optional)
directions
- Thaw peas in colander under running water for a minute; drain.
- Combine all ingredients.
- Chill for a couple of hours to marry the flavors.
- Garnish just before serving.

I have made this recipe numerous times over the past 5 years,,,always a hit! I concur that bacon is a necessary ingredient. I use 1/2 cup Hormel bacon bits. I try to find the orange cauliflower for color and garnish the salad with dried dill. Depending on the preferences of those I'm serving, I'll vary the sour cream with plain yogurt. For dressing, I always seek Bolthouse Yogurt dressings. Ranch, Bleu Cheese or Avocado/Cilantro are all delicious dressings with this salad.
